MCS Music America, which owns the copyrights for 45,000 songs, claims that Napster is selling the songs controlled by MCS without obtaining licenses.
Napster sent a form to MCS seeking an agreement but neither party signed the agreement. MCS is asking Napster to pay $150,000 which shouldn’t be much for the cat to cough up.
